Transaction 3dae6332d521788abbc9da8845a2de0b0397fe609469a23f7209651e365fe45e
2 Input
2 Outputs
- 3dae6332d521788abbc9da8845a2de0b0397fe609469a23f7209651e365fe45e:0
- 3dae6332d521788abbc9da8845a2de0b0397fe609469a23f7209651e365fe45e:1
value 468400
address 121SH5NAGVC9fCKU8yZjfpcewsWA8dFm9Q
value 31234
address 1FKKZd9UxhCp9pBsWCv37MMZB7r7ca7DdL